What You’ll Do
  • Complete an initial assessment of patient and family to determine home care needs. Provides a complete physical assessment and history of current and previous illness(es).
  • Observe and report any signs or symptoms indicative of changes in condition of the patient and family situation. Document such reports and observations in the clinical record and notify supervisor.
  • Regularly re-evaluates patient nursing needs.
  • Initiates the plan of care and makes necessary revisions as patient status and needs change.
  • Uses health assessment data to determine nursing diagnosis.
  • Develops a care plan, which establishes goals based on nursing diagnosis and incorporates therapeutic, preventive, and rehabilitative nursing actions. Includes the patient and the family in the planning process.
  • Initiates appropriate preventive and rehabilitative nursing procedures. Administers medications and treatments as prescribed by the provider.
  • Provides direct patient care as defined in the State Nurse Practice Act.
  • Counsels the patient and family in meeting nursing and related needs.
  • Provides health care instructions to the patient as appropriate per assessment and plan of care.
  • Identifies discharge planning needs as part of the care plan development and implements prior to discharge of the patient.
  • Acts as Case Manager when assigned by Clinical Supervisor and assumes responsibility to coordinate patient care for assigned caseload.
  • Prepares clinical notes and updates the primary provider when necessary and at least every 60 days.
  • Communicates with all relevant providers regarding the patient’s needs and reports any changes in the patient’s condition; obtains/receives orders as required.
  • Communicates with community health related persons to coordinate the care plan.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
Qualifications
  • Graduate from an accredited registered nursing program and licensed in the state.
  • At least one (1) year clinical practical nursing experience preferably in intensive care, rehabilitation or medical surgical nursing (preferred).
  • Home health experience preferred.
  • Possess and maintain valid CPR certification.
  • Must have reliable transportation, current driver's license and appropriate automobile insurance.
